Like I said before, with the smaller 26" tire, I'd stay between 3.23 and 3.73 ratio until you get up over 135 MPH trapspeed, then I'd consider dropping the ratio down further and/or increasing the tire diameter.
As a general rule, nitrous will like the lower of two gear ratios with most combinations.
Also as a general rule, the fewer teeth on the ring gear is stronger.

You should be find with the 373's and nitrious.Like someone said before nitrious likes taller gears.I had 26" tire with 150 shot and 410's on a 12 bolt and would run out of gear in the quarter.So I switched to a 28" tire to take care of that problem.Now a trap 127 mph at 6400 rpm's.Dont waste your money on a new r/p (410's) If you gonna spray alot you might end up like me running out of gear.
